You can use the juicer to get juice from practically all fruits and vegetables, whether they are hard or soft. However, you will not manage to extract juice from bananas, coconuts, avocado pears, blackberries, figs and aubergines Do not use the juicer to extract juice from fruit or vegetables that are too hard and fibrous, such as ginger, celeria, sugar cane, etc.

4 B - PRACTICAL HINTS ON USING YOUR JUICER Choose fresh, ripe fruit and vegetables.

2. Carefully wash the fruit and vegetables before cutting them and removing the

3. Peel thick-skinned fruit such as lemons, oranges and grapefruits (bitter thick

skins) or pineapples (remove the core).

4. The juicier the fruit (as with tomatoes) the slower the speed you should use (see

table above for information).

5. If you prepare juice from grapes, quinces, blueberries or blackcurrant, you should

clean the filter every time you press 1/2 kg.

6. If you juice over-ripe fruit, you will obtain a fairly thick liquid, the filter will tend

to get clogged up and you should then clean it more regularly. You will also have to empty the pulp container more or less often according to the quality of the fruit or vegetables processed.

7. Important: all juices should be drunk immediately. When they come into

contact with the air, they oxidise very quickly and this may impair their taste and colour. Apple and pear juice quickly takes on a brown colour. Add a few drops of lemon to prevent the juice going brown too quickly.

6. Cleaning and maintenance

+ Allthe removable juicer parts (A, B, C, D, E, M, N) can be cleaned in the dishwasher. - The citrus-press accessory parts (K, L) cannot be washed in the dishwasher. Wash them under running water. « This appliance is easier to clean if you do it immediately after use. + Do not use scouring pads, acetone, alcohol (white spirit) etc. to clean your appliance.

+ The filter must be handled with care. Avoid any improper handling which may cause damage. The filter can be cleaned with the brush (0). Replace the filter as soon as it shows signs of wear or tear. + Wipe the motor unit down with a damp cloth. Dry it carefully. + Never place the motor unit under a running tap.
